Update to Key-type

Car key technology has developed dramatically over the years. Now, it is common to find keys for cars with an embedded chip in the head. The chip is able to communicate with the car's security system. These keys, also known as Fobik remote key are a significant improvement from the traditional mechanical cut metal keys that can be duplicated at any hardware store. The process of duplicate keys for this type requires specific tools and a good understanding of how to use these tools.

If you're looking to purchase a new car key, an automotive locksmith can assist you in determining the best option. It will depend on your car's model, make, and year. To make the most exact copy of your key, the locksmith will need a specific piece of software that can identify the proper key code for your car. Then, they can utilize a laser to curve out articulated grooves on both sides of the key. The end result is an accurate key that will not cause any problems with your ignition switch.

Car lockouts

Lockouts can happen at the worst possible moment. Luckily, professional locksmiths can assist you in solving this issue without having to break your windows. They also offer competitive rates and are available around the clock. Some even offer mobile services, making them a convenient option for people who are always on the move.

Many people have locked themselves out of their cars and panicked the moment they realized the situation. They should remain calm and locate a safe area first. If they have children or elderly passengers stuck inside, they must call 911. This will ensure their safety is not compromised. Additionally, they can get help from the automaker if they have a new or certified pre-owned vehicle.

One of the most common reasons for a car lockout is dead batteries. Other causes could be damage to the key fob, a damaged door lock or foreign objects that are inside the locks. However, the main reason for a car lockout is that burglars have tampered with the locks.

The best way to prevent being locked out of your vehicle is to always keep an extra key. You should also make sure to check the battery of your car regularly and replace it if it's low. You should also ensure that your keys are kept in an area that is secure and not readily accessible.

A car lockout kit is a different option to avoid the possibility of being locked out. These kits can be found at a variety of large stores and online. They include a range of tools that can help you open your car. The majority of these kits cost $100 or less and are a much cheaper alternative to calling a locksmith. They aren't foolproof, and you could still be locked out of your car.

In addition to using a lockout kit for your car or a car lockout kit, you could also try using the string or wire hanger to unlock the door. This method is effective in the case of a traditional post-type door. However, this trick won't be effective on modern vehicles equipped with key fobs or security alarm. In addition, it can cause serious damage to the car's exterior and window.

Duplicate keys

Losing keys is a normal but stressful event that can make your life difficult. A locksmith can help by creating duplicates so that you can get into your house or vehicle in the event that you lose the original set. These copies can also be useful in granting access to other service providers, such as pet sitters and cleaners.

Duplicate keys can be useful in an emergency. However, they have their flaws. For instance, low-quality duplicates are prone to breakage which could cause locks to malfunction, and even fail. It could be because they're not sized properly or have a damaged keyway. You can prevent these issues by ensuring that your duplicate keys are of top quality.

Apart from reducing the possibility of losing your keys, duplicate keys are also affordable when compared to replacing a complete lockset. They are available at most hardware stores, but you should always employ a professional to create your spare keys.

Many people are unaware of the fact that the key-duplication process can leave some bits and pieces of information that aren't transferred to the new copy. In the end, the duplicate may have different internal components and a different design than the original key. This could cause a variety of issues, such as a malfunctioning lock operation, or even damage to the ignition switch or door lock.

Vehicle Security

Vehicle security is a complex issue that requires a variety of considerations to protect your vehicles and the people who use them. There are a variety of options however, they differ in cost and effectiveness. Some of the most effective are alarm systems, vehicle tracking and GPS systems. These systems are simple to install and can reduce the likelihood of vandalism or theft. They can also be used to locate and recover stolen vehicles.

Remove valuables from vehicles that are parked. This deters thieves from breaking windows to take valuable items. Parking locksmiths car key in secure areas is also important. Secure the doors and windows of your car when you leave it unattended.

It is also important to verify the condition of the security features on your vehicle prior to buying it. Check that the alarm and locks are in good order. It is also important to take any valuables out of the vehicle overnight and to keep them locked away in a secure box. Consider tinting the windows of your vehicle. This will stop criminals from getting a glimpse of what's inside and may deter them.
